If you find an older 2wd trans (pre-1996 I think) you can use that. There are a lot of old Legacy wagons out there that are 2WD from the mid-90's. Otherwise you would have to convert a newer awd trans which would be pretty hard. I think someone here is doing it but it's very complicated. The 4EAT AWD trans is very long, weighs 275 lbs, is run by a separate computer (which you would need the ECU for as well), and would be hard to fit because of where certain components are.
